How Peripheral Neuropathy Affects Your Feet and What You Can Do About It

copy link

Peripheral neuropathy occurs when peripheral nerves become damaged, causing a breakdown in communication within the nervous system. Because the longest nerves in the body reach the extremities, symptoms most commonly and initially affect the feet. When this nerve damage develops, sensations like numbness, tingling, burning, and muscle weakness frequently follow. Furthermore, a reduced ability to detect pain or injuries makes everyday foot care significantly more critical, as minor cuts can easily go unnoticed.

To effectively navigate this condition, this article will answer two vital questions: How does peripheral neuropathy affect the feet? And what practical steps can people take to protect their feet and manage the condition?

What Is Peripheral Neuropathy?

Peripheral neuropathy is a condition that describes a breakdown in the two-way communication network between the central nervous system (the brain and spinal cord) and the rest of the body. When peripheral nerves are damaged, they may send distorted signals, fail to transmit signals altogether, or fire spontaneously.

This damage can interfere with three distinct types of nerve functions: sensory nerves that detect touch and temperature, motor nerves that control muscle movement, and autonomic nerves that manage involuntary internal functions.

Clinically, the symptoms often follow a "stocking and glove" pattern. This means the sensory distortions typically begin in the furthest parts of the limbs, starting first in the toes and feet, before gradually progressing upward into the legs and eventually the hands. While peripheral neuropathy can have numerous underlying causes, it is particularly associated with long-term diabetes.

How Peripheral Neuropathy Affects Your Feet

Numbness, Tingling, and Burning

When sensory nerves in the feet are damaged, individuals often experience extreme sensory distortions. This can include a persistent "pins-and-needles" feeling, burning sensations, or sharp, electric-shock-like pain. Paradoxically, neuropathy can cause both extreme sensitivity (where the light touch of a bedsheet feels painful) and profound numbness. This combination of numbness and hypersensitivity is often bilateral and relatively symmetric, though symptoms do not always affect both feet equally.

Muscle Weakness and Balance Problems

If motor nerves are damaged, the structural integrity of the foot is compromised. This damage can lead to muscle atrophy and a condition known as "foot drop," which makes it difficult to lift the front of the foot. Furthermore, the loss of proprioception, the awareness of where your feet are in space, severely impacts postural control. Peripheral neuropathy can also increase fall risk in older adults by impairing balance, proprioception, and postural control.

Cuts, Blisters, and Other Injuries Can Go Unnoticed

The most dangerous aspect of neuropathy is the loss of protective sensation, which creates a "silent injury" loop. Because the body's primary warning system is blunted, repetitive friction, cuts, or blisters can go completely unnoticed. When neuropathy is accompanied by peripheral artery disease or other circulation problems, these undetected injuries may heal more slowly, increasing the risk of severe foot ulcers, infections, and, in serious cases, amputation.

Why Proper Footwear Matters When Sensation Is Reduced

Because patients cannot rely on pain to warn them of friction or pressure points, physical foot protection is critical. 

Well-fitting shoes for neuropathy can provide appropriate room, cushioning, and protection, while some people with high-risk foot conditions may require specialized therapeutic footwear. Proper footwear should feature adequate toe room to accommodate deformities, sufficient width and depth, supportive cushioning to redistribute plantar pressure, and low-friction interiors without protruding seams. These specific features serve as a practical, external protective measure against injuries, though they do not cure the underlying nerve damage.

What Causes Peripheral Neuropathy in the Feet?

Peripheral neuropathy is a description of nerve damage, not a single standalone disease. Identifying the root cause is critical for long-term management.

The most common driver is diabetes. Long-term high blood sugar and related metabolic and vascular changes can damage peripheral nerves over time.

Beyond diabetes, several other factors can trigger neuropathy in the feet. Vitamin B12 deficiency can cause peripheral neuropathy, while excessive vitamin B6 intake is also a recognized cause. Certain medications, including some chemotherapy drugs, can directly cause neuropathy, while long-term metformin use may contribute indirectly by increasing the risk of vitamin B12 deficiency.

Other potential causes include chronic alcohol use, which is toxic to nerve tissue, and autoimmune conditions like Guillain-Barré syndrome, where the immune system attacks peripheral nerves. Physical injuries, chronic infections, and inherited disorders also play a role. In many cases, the exact cause cannot be identified, which is categorized as idiopathic peripheral neuropathy.

How to Protect Your Feet When You Have Peripheral Neuropathy

Because peripheral neuropathy blunts your body’s natural warning signals, proactive daily foot care becomes the primary defense against severe structural complications and infections.

Check Your Feet Every Day

You must rely on your eyes to compensate for a lack of physical sensation. Perform a visual check of your feet daily at the same time and under consistent, high-quality lighting. Look closely for cuts, blisters, redness, swelling, cracks, or pressure marks. If you have trouble seeing the bottom of your feet, use a mirror or ask a family member for assistance to ensure you do not miss early signs of sores.

Avoid Going Barefoot

Never walk barefoot, even indoors. Without protective sensation, you risk stepping on sharp objects, getting splinters, or burning your feet on hot surfaces without realizing it. Always wear well-fitting, protective footwear to shield your feet from minor physical trauma.

Take Care of Your Skin and Nails

Autonomic nerve damage can reduce sweat and oil production, leaving the skin on your feet excessively dry and prone to cracking. Keep your feet clean by washing them daily in lukewarm water, but always test the temperature with your elbow or a thermometer first to prevent thermal burns. Dry them thoroughly and apply lotion to prevent cracks. For safe nail trimming and callus management, avoid chemical corn removers; instead, seek professional podiatric help.

Manage the Underlying Condition

Identifying and managing the underlying cause is a central part of preventing or slowing further nerve damage when possible. For those with diabetic neuropathy, keeping blood glucose within an individualized target range can help prevent or slow further nerve damage. Maintaining stable blood glucose levels helps prevent further loss of small nerve fibers.

How Is Peripheral Neuropathy Diagnosed?

Diagnosing peripheral neuropathy requires a multi-modal approach, emphasizing professional medical assessment over self-diagnosis.

A clinician will begin by taking a detailed medical history and reviewing your specific symptoms, looking for toxin exposure, family history, or metabolic diseases. This is followed by a physical and neurological exam to assess muscle strength, gait, and balance.

To assess sensory function, clinicians may use a 128-Hz tuning fork to test vibration sensitivity and a 10-g nylon monofilament to identify loss of protective sensation in the feet.

If initial clinical findings point to neuropathy, diagnostic blood tests are ordered to identify the underlying cause, checking for diabetes (A1C) and vitamin B12 levels. In selected cases, particularly when symptoms are atypical or the diagnosis remains unclear, specialists may use nerve conduction studies (NCS) and electromyography (EMG) to further characterize nerve and muscle function.

How Is Peripheral Neuropathy Treated?

The treatment for peripheral neuropathy depends entirely on the underlying cause. While some damage may improve or be reversed if caught early, other forms require long-term management to prevent progression.

Treating the root disease is the primary objective. This involves managing underlying conditions, such as achieving strict blood glucose control for diabetes, or correcting nutritional deficits with Vitamin B12 supplementation.

For symptom management, standard over-the-counter pain relievers often do not work well for neuropathic pain, although they may help some mild symptoms. Instead, physicians may prescribe specific neuropathic pain medications, such as anti-seizure drugs (gabapentin) or certain antidepressants that alter how the brain processes pain signals.

Non-pharmacological treatments are also critical. Physical therapy and the use of mobility support, such as ankle-foot orthoses, help correct balance issues. Finally, implementing strict foot-care measures is essential to protect vulnerable tissue while the nerve condition is managed.

When Should You See a Healthcare Professional?

Early medical assessment offers the best chance to halt nerve damage. Seek professional evaluation if you experience new or worsening numbness, persistent tingling or burning, muscle weakness, or difficulty walking. Prompt medical attention is especially important for open or slow-healing wounds, signs of infection, unexplained redness or swelling, or a foot that suddenly becomes unusually warm.
